Dissolved Counties:
Arapaho 30 Aug 1855 - absorbed into Finney 1883.
El Paso 11 Feb 1859 and later disorganized.
Fremont 11 Feb 1859, later disorganized.
Broderick 11 Feb 1859, later disorganized.
Buffalo 1873, disorganized 1881, land annexed to Lane County.
Garfield 5 Mar 1887, annexed to Finney 1893.
Hageman 26 Feb 1867, later disorganized.
Howard 30 Aug 1855, reorganized into Elk and Chautauqua.
Irving 27 Feb 1860, annexed to Butler 1864.
Kansas 6 Mar 1873, annexed to Seward 1883.
Oro 11 Feb 1859, later disorganized.
Montana 11 Feb 1859, later disorganized.
Peketon 27 Feb 1860, later disorganized.
Otoe 27 Feb 1860, annexed to Butler 1864.
Rush 26 Feb 1867, later disorganized 1883.
Sequoyah 30 Aug 1855, renamed Finney 21 Feb 1883.
Shelby 1865, annexed by Washington.
Woodson 30 Aug 1855, had major boundary changes in 1868.
